Heads up:
We’re moving the GATK website, docs and forum to a new platform. Read the full story and breakdown of key changes on this blog.
Update: July 26, 2019
This section of the forum is now closed; we are working on a new support model for WDL that we will share here shortly. For Cromwell-specific issues, see the Cromwell docs and post questions on Github.

How to enforce ordering between tasks in a workflow?

I created a simple linear workflow which has calls like this :

so my use case is that task1 needs to be executed first followed by task2 and then task3.

So my question is there some way in wdl to force that task1 is always executed before task2.


  • vinay_isvinay_is Member
    Sometimes while running this workflow I have seen task2 occurs first followed by task 1 which messes up my task3. So I want a strict ordering where task1 needs to be executed first, task 2 second and task 3 third
Sign In or Register to comment.